Monotonicity and enclosure methods for the p-Laplace equation

Abstract

We show that the convex hull of a monotone perturbation of a homogeneous background conductivity in the pp-conductivity equation is determined by knowledge of the nonlinear Dirichlet-Neumann operator. We give two independent proofs, one of which is based on the monotonicity method and the other on the enclosure method. Our results are constructive and require no jump or smoothness properties on the conductivity perturbation or its support.
